About Josh Jacobs
Running back who has risen to fame for his career playing for the Alabama Crimson Tide. He was named the 2018 SEC Championship MVP en route to Alabama's fourth straight appearance in the College Football Championship game. He joined the Las Vegas Raiders in 2019.
Before Fame
He was a three-star Rivals recruit as a senior in high school. He signed his letter of intent to play for the Crimson Tide with under a month until national signing day.
Trivia
He won the SEC Title with Alabama in both 2016 and 2018. He won his first national championship in the 2017-2018 season.
Family Life
His younger brother, Isaiah Jacobs, played running back for the Maryland Terrapins.
Associated With
He has played alongside Tua Tagovailoa for the Alabama Crimson Tide.
